Countries with the Highest Female Mortality Rate (2023)

Source: World Bank·25 countries·Updated 2023

Female adult mortality is highest where maternal health and healthcare access are weakest. {#1} leads at {#1_value} per 1,000.

Lesotho leads with mortality rate, adult female (per 1,000) of 361.6.

Nigeria ranks #2 at 342.6.

Central African Republic ranks #3 at 326.8.

Chad ranks #4 at 309.4.

Nauru ranks #5 at 306.9.
